Stützpunkt auf der Achse (P-CHAN-00293)
P-CHAN-00293 | Stützpunkt auf der Achse (Universelle Kinematik) |
Beschreibung | Parameter definiert einen Stützpunkt auf der Achse (Position X, Y, Z, nur relevant bei Rundachsen). |
Parameter | trafo[j].axis[k].point[l] mit l = 0, 1, 2 kin_step[i].trafo[j].axis[k].point[l] (mehrstufige Transformationen) kinematik[91].axis[k].point[l] (bis Version V2.11.28xx) |
Datentyp | REAL64 |
Datenbereich | ---- |
Dimension | 0.1µm |
Standardwert | 0 |
Anmerkungen |
|
Konfiguration der Universellen Kinematik in Kanalparameterliste:
# Null-Orientierung des Werkzeuges
# Werkzeug zeigt in Z-Richtung
kinematik[91].zero_orientation[0] 0
kinematik[91].zero_orientation[1] 0
kinematik[91].zero_orientation[2] 1
# Null-Position des Werkzeuges
# Werkzeug ruht im Punkt (12000, -3200, 500)
kinematik[91].zero_position[0] 12000
kinematik[91].zero_position[1] -3200
kinematik[91].zero_position[2] 500
kinematik[91].number_of_axes 5
kinematik[91].programming_mode 17
kinematik[91].rtcp 1
# X-Achse definieren (Index 0)
kinematik[91].axis[0].type 1
kinematik[91].axis[0].orientation[0] 1
kinematik[91].axis[0].orientation[1] 0
kinematik[91].axis[0].orientation[2] 0
...
# Y-Achse definieren (Index 1)
kinematik[91].axis[1].type 1
kinematik[91].axis[1].orientation[0] 0
kinematik[91].axis[1].orientation[1] 1
kinematik[91].axis[1].orientation[2] 0
...
# Z-Achse definieren (Index 2)
kinematik[91].axis[2].type 1
kinematik[91].axis[2].orientation[0] 0
kinematik[91].axis[2].orientation[1] 0
kinematik[91].axis[2].orientation[2] 1
...
# C-Achse definieren (Index 3)
# zeigt in Z-Richtung und läuft durch
# den Punkt (800, 1200, 0)
kinematik[91].axis[3].type 2
kinematik[91].axis[3].orientation[0] 0
kinematik[91].axis[3].orientation[1] 0
kinematik[91].axis[3].orientation[2] 1
kinematik[91].axis[3].point[0] 800
kinematik[91].axis[3].point[1] 1200
kinematik[91].axis[3].point[2] 0
# A-Achse definieren (Index 4)
kinematik[91].axis[4].type 2
kinematik[91].axis[4].orientation[0] 1
kinematik[91].axis[4].orientation[1] 0
kinematik[91].axis[4].orientation[2] 0
...
# Reihenfolge in kin. Kette: YXZCA
kinematik[91].chain[0] 1 # Y-Achse
kinematik[91].chain[1] 0 # X-Achse
kinematik[91].chain[2] 2 # Z-Achse
kinematik[91].chain[3] 3 # C-Achse
kinematik[91].chain[4] 4 # A-Achse